New York: Vanguard Press, 1947. 1947 Edition. Hardcover. Very good/Very good. Duodecimo. 5.25 x 7.5 in. 313 pp. Near fine in original decorated black cloth boards and very good pictorial price-clipped dust jacket with light wear to corners, chip to head, and a round red sticker to foot of spine. Stout's first novel originally published in 1929.
Sinopsis
In 1929, Stout wrote his first published book How Like a God , an unusual psychological story told in the second person, in a man's mind as he walks up several flights of stairs.
